Unraveling the Blockchain: From Transactions to copyright

The blockchain is a revolutionary technology that has transformed the way we think about finance. At its core, it's a decentralized ledger that records every transaction in a encrypted and transparent manner. Each transaction is grouped into a block, which is then connected to the previous block, forming an immutable record. This structure ensures that data is reliable and tamper-proof

Digital currencies like Bitcoin rely on this blockchain system to enable secure and anonymous transfers.

Digging Deep into Doge

Dogecoin, the digital asset born from internet humor, has become a serious player in the blockchain world. While its origins were pure whimsy, Dogecoin mining has emerged as a unique industry, attracting investors with its potential for rewards. Miners battle to solve complex algorithms, verifying transactions and adding new blocks to the Dogecoin blockchain. This relentless pursuit of Doge has transformed it from a joke into a legitimateinvestment.

But is Dogecoin mining worthwhile? The answer depends on a number of factors, including technology, energy bills, and the ever-fluctuating value of Doge itself. Despite the risks, Dogecoin mining remains an intriguing opportunity for those willing to join the fray.

Grasping Hash Rates: The Key to Effective copyright Mining

In the dynamic realm of copyright mining, hash rate stands as a fundamental determinant of success. A higher hash rate equates to a greater ability to ltc mining solve complex cryptographic problems and earn coveted rewards. Miners leverage specialized hardware known as ASICs to generate these computational solutions. Understanding the intricacies of hash rates empowers miners to make informed decisions regarding their mining infrastructure.
